Corn starch,cassava starch and amylomaize were utilized to produce cycloamylose in this study. These three substrates were debranched by isoamylase first. Then they were treated with 4-α-glucanotransferase to produce cycloamylose. The results indicated that after debranching,the maximum conversion yield of cycloamylose from corn starch increased from 20. 3% to 33. 6%( 1. 7 folds); the maximum conversion yield of cycloamylose from cassava starch increased from 16. 82% to 32. 4%( 1. 9 folds); the maximum conversion yield of cycloamylose from amylomaize increased from 24. 53% to 44. 07%( 1. 8 folds). Therefore,it was an efficient method to produce cycloamylose by combined treatment of isoamylase and 4-α-glucanotransferase. The study also showed the method has a great potential in the industrial scale.
